VALDEZ HIGH SCHOOL TOOK FIRST IN STATE AT ACADEMIC DECATHLON
Last weekend the VHS Academic Decathlon team traveled up to Anchorage to compete in state competition for Division II. This year the team consisted of eight kids who, over the course of the weekend, racked up a score of 31,994.6. On the final day of competition Valdez was awarded first place for Division II.

NEW RECORD SET IN THE GMS TOOTHPICK TOWER COMPETITION

Every year, Gilson Middle School has a toothpick tower competition to simulate what steel brought to the Industrial Revolution. Grace Keller’s tower held a whopping 1,250.75 lbs. and did not break, setting a new record. Overall, this was the best year they’ve had, with two other towers holding over 600 lbs. Ashlee Schaeffer and Elayzia Nicolette had a tower that held 664.5 lbs. followed by Sophia Palomar and Jackie Stewart whose tower held 629 lbs.   
 
GMS BATTLE BOOK TEAM HEADED TO KETCHIKAN

On Tuesday, February 23, the GMS Battle Book Team competed in the State Battle of the Books. They were up against Anchorage, Ketchikan, Nenana and Yukon Flats for Round One. Thirty different Middle School teams competed in round one, with the top 12 teams moving on to round two. The Huskies made it to the second round of competition. They placed 11th overall in State Battles.
